The 2025 Akwa Ibom State FA Cup is heating up as defending champions Akwa United FC prepare to battle debutants Godswill Akpabio United FC in a highly anticipated semi-final clash at the Uyo Township Stadium on Friday, February 21, 2025, at 3:00 PM.

Akwa United, the tournament’s most successful club, enter the match with experience and a winning mentality. Under coach Kennedy Boboye, they secured their spot in the semi-finals with a solid 3-1 victory over Pillars Investors Academy. The team is determined to defend their title and extend their dominance in the competition.

On the other hand, Godswill Akpabio United FC are making a dream debut in the tournament. Led by coach Patrick Udoh, they have already made headlines with their attacking prowess, thrashing Regnant Academy 6-0 in the quarter-finals. Despite being newcomers, they have proven they can compete with the best and will be eager to upset the reigning champions.

Both teams have everything to play for. Akwa United seek to continue their reign, while Godswill Akpabio United aim to announce themselves in style. The winner will face Eagle Eye Academy in the final on Sunday, February 23, 2025, and earn a ticket to represent Akwa Ibom at the national finals of the President Federation Cup.
